Name:           akmods
Version:        0.5.6
Release:        10%{?dist}
Summary:        Automatic kmods build and install tool 

License:        MIT
URL:            http://rpmfusion.org/Packaging/KernelModules/Akmods

# We are upstream, these files are maintained directly in pkg-git
Source0:        95-akmods.preset
Source1:        akmods
Source2:        akmodsbuild
Source3:        akmods.h2m
Source4:        akmodsinit
Source5:        akmodsposttrans
Source6:        akmods.service.in
Source7:        akmods-shutdown
Source8:        akmods-shutdown.service
Source9:        README
Source10:       LICENSE

BuildArch:      noarch

BuildRequires:  help2man

# not picked up automatically
Requires:       %{_bindir}/nohup
Requires:       %{_bindir}/flock
Requires:       %{_bindir}/time

# needed for actually building kmods:
Requires:       %{_bindir}/rpmdev-vercmp
Requires:       kmodtool >= 1-9

# this should track in all stuff that is normally needed to compile modules:
Requires:       bzip2 coreutils diffutils file findutils gawk gcc grep
Requires:       gzip make sed tar unzip util-linux which rpm-build

# We use a virtual provide that would match either
# kernel-devel or kernel-PAE-devel
Requires:       kernel-devel-uname-r
%if 0%{?fedora}
Suggests:       (kernel-debug-devel if kernel-debug)
Suggests:       (kernel-devel if kernel)
Suggests:       (kernel-lpae-devel if kernel-lpae)
Suggests:       (kernel-PAE-devel if kernel-PAE)
Suggests:       (kernel-PAEdebug-devel if kernel-PAEdebug)
# Theses are from planetccrma-core or rhel-7-server-rt-rpms
Suggests:       (kernel-rt-devel if kernel-rt)
Suggests:       (kernel-rtPAE-devel if kernel-rtPAE)
%endif

# we create a special user that used by akmods to build kmod packages
Requires(pre):  shadow-utils

%if 0%{?fedora} || 0%{?rhel} > 6
# systemd unit requirements.
BuildRequires:  systemd
Requires(post): systemd
Requires(preun): systemd
Requires(postun): systemd
# Optional but good to have on recent kernel
Requires: elfutils-libelf-devel
%endif


%description
Akmods startup script will rebuild akmod packages during system 
boot while its background daemon will build them for kernels right
after they were installed.

%changelog
* Thu Aug 03 2017 Nicolas Chauvet <kwizart@gmail.com> - 0.5.6-10
- Enable suggests on fedora
- Add back el6 support in spec
- Add Requires elfutils-libelf-devel

* Wed Jul 26 2017 Fedora Release Engineering <releng@fedoraproject.org> - 0.5.6-9
- Rebuilt for https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Fedora_27_Mass_Rebuild

* Thu Jul 13 2017 Petr Pisar <ppisar@redhat.com> - 0.5.6-8
- perl dependency renamed to perl-interpreter
  <https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Changes/perl_Package_to_Install_Core_Modules>

* Thu May  4 2017 Hans de Goede <hdegoede@redhat.com> - 0.5.6-7
- "udevadm trigger" may have bad side-effects (rhbz#454407) instead
  look for modalias files under /sys/devices and call modprobe directly
- Fix exit status when no akmod packages are installed, so that systemd
  does not consider the akmods.service as having failed to start

* Wed May  3 2017 Hans de Goede <hdegoede@redhat.com> - 0.5.6-6
- Run "udevadm trigger" and "systemctl restart systemd-modules-load.service"
  when new kmod packages have been build and installed so that the new
  modules may be used immediately without requiring a reboot
